Centrecare is the main social services agency of the Catholic Archdiocese of Perth, in Western Australia. Since June 1977, a range of family and social services programs have operated as Centrecare, which was registered as a charity on 1 January 1986.
Services offered under the names of the Catholic Family Welfare Bureau, Catholic Family Services and Centrecare Marriage and Family Services all came under the Centrecare umbrella by 1977. Centrecare, through various programs, has been involved in running out of home care facilities in Western Australia since the 1970s.
